I went through the same thing last week! I had to fast all day Tuesday for pre-op testing and then the next day go straight to the 2 week liquid diet. It is hard but you can do it! I have had minimal issues; the only thing that I have really wanted or missed is salad, which I did give in one day and have. But hey, I ain’t perfect <_< ! My diet consist of Opti-fast, which is four shakes, a Protein Bar, and a pack of Soup. The food taste pretty decent. Also be sure to try variety! I know on my diet I can also have sugar free Jello and sugar free popsicles, so I am going to pick that up today! You can do this, trust me! When is your surgery date???

Thanks, all - today is Day 1 of 14, with my surgery on May 21. I'm very excited! I get 4-5 Bariatric Advantage shakes + other clear and sugar free liquids (Jello, popsicles, too). My last unsleeved diet, a great way to look at it.

I'm wondering how I'm going to feel about working out these next two weeks before surgery. I'm going to miss my pole dance classes while I'm recuperating, I hope I'm up for it while I'm pre-op, but a lot of folks have mentioned being really weak. I probably can throw another Protein shake in if I'm exerting myself in class - extra Protein shouldn't be too bad. I'll talk to the nutritionist.
